Job Description
The Superintendent will oversee day-to-day operations and manage the construction of a luxury ground-up multifamily project valued at over $100 million. Client Details About the client: Office in Boston, MA Completes Luxury, Ground Up Multifamily around $100M 3rd largest Multifamily Builder/ Developer in the nation around 30 employees in the Boston office Markets Served: Large Scale, Luxury Multifamily projects $100M+ "Small Shop" with the resources of a large GC due to their national presence Description Manage daily on-site activities to ensure the project stays on schedule and meets quality standards. Coordinate with subcontractors, suppliers, and the project team to maintain smooth operations. Monitor and enforce safety protocols to ensure a safe work environment. Conduct regular site inspections to guarantee compliance with plans and specifications. Assist in resolving any on-site construction issues promptly and effectively. Communicate progress updates and challenges to the Project Manager and stakeholders. Support the implementation of project schedules and timelines. Maintain accurate documentation and records of site activities and progress. Profile A successful Superintendent should have: Experience with large-scale ground-up multifamily construction projects. Knowledge of construction processes, safety regulations, and best practices. Strong organizational and communication skills for effective coordination with teams. Ability to read and interpret construction plans and specifications. Problem-solving skills to address on-site challenges efficiently. Commitment to maintaining high-quality standards throughout the project.
